I like Carters for the good, oldfashioned basics that don’t want to make little girls look like hoochie mamas.
If you have money to spend, mini-boden has THE best clothes online. Adorable. Lovely. Sweet.
Gap Kids is catch as can catch-some things are great and some aspire to make babies look like little teenagers. The quality is always good.
Children’s Place and Old Navy are great for stocking up on the must have basics-socks-onesies-tees, etc.References :
